Output 3b181d92910145d66c2351ec2eb53f3a8e97ce66c06d561917ab1238d7034702:44

value
2940722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7990e7c1e15c5680d84262316980bb53513b7e38 OP_EQUAL
address
3CmoGxBEPwar5o72qUgCCt31fPM7msso1r
transaction
3b181d92910145d66c2351ec2eb53f3a8e97ce66c06d561917ab1238d7034702
confirmations
276748
spent
true